पातु प्रतीच्यामक्षघ्नः सौम्ये सागरतारकः
May he who destroys misfortune, gentle and ocean-crossing, protect from the west.
अधस्ताद्विष्णुभक्तस्तु पातु मध्ये च पावनिः
Below, may the devotee of Viṣṇu protect, and in the middle, the purifier.
सुग्रीवसचिवः पातु मस्तकं वायुनन्दनः
May the son of the wind, Sugrīva’s minister, protect the head.
नेत्रे छायापहारी च पातु नः प्लवगेश्वरः
May the lord of the monkeys, who dispels darkness, protect our eyes.
नासाग्रमञ्जनासूनुः पातु वक्त्रं हरीश्वरः
May the son of Aṅjanā protect the tip of the nose, and the lord of monkeys the mouth.
भुजौ पातु महातेजाः करौ च चरणायुधः
May the mighty one protect the arms, and he who wields weapons with hands and feet protect the hands.
वक्षो मुद्रापहारी च पातु पार्श्वे भुजायुधः
May he who took the ring protect the chest, and he who wields arms as weapons protect the sides.
नाभिं श्रीरामभक्तस्तु कटिं पात्वनिलात्मजः
May the devotee of Śrī Rāma protect the navel, and the son of the wind protect the waist.
ऊरू च जानुनी पातु लङ्काप्रासादभञ्जनः
May the destroyer of the palaces of Laṅkā protect the thighs and knees.
अचलोद्धारकः पातु पादौ भास्करसन्निभः
May he who lifted the mountain, radiant as the sun, protect the feet.
